反相超高效液相色谱-串联质谱法测定大米中氯酸盐和高氯酸盐 被引量:11

Determination of chlorate and perchlorate in rice by reversed-phase ultra performance liquid chromatography-tandem mass spectrometry

摘要 目的建立反相超高效液相 -串联质谱 (high performance liquid chromatography-tandem mass spectrometry, HPLC-MS/MS)测定大米中氯酸盐和高氯酸盐的方法。方法大米样品采用水和甲醇提取,经固相萃取(solid-phase extraction, SPE)净化,在电喷雾离子源负离子多反应监测(multiple reaction monitoring, MRM)模式下进行测定,内标法定量。结果 氯酸盐和高氯酸盐在 1.00~200 ng/m L 范围内线性关系良好(r>0.9955), 方法检出限为 4.0~6.0 μg/kg。添加水平分别为 12.5、25、50 μg/kg 时,加标回收率为 82.7%~99.5%, 相对标准偏差为 1.01%~7.90%。结论 该方法简便、灵敏度高,适用于大米中氯酸盐和高氯酸盐的检测。 Objective To establish a method for the determination of chlorate and perchlorate in rice by reversed-phase ultra performance liquid chromatography-tandem mass spectrometry. Methods The rice samples were extracted with water and methanol, and purified by solid-phase extraction(SPE). The samples were determined by multiple reaction monitoring(MRM) mode under electrospray ionization and quantified by internal standard method. Results The linear relationship between chlorate and perchlorate in the range of 1.00-200 ng/mL was good(r>0.9955), and the detection limit of the method was 4.0-6.0 μg/kg. When the addition levels were 12.5, 25, 50 μg/kg, the recoveries were 82.7%-99.5%, and the relative standard deviations were 1.01%-7.90%. Conclusion The method is simple, sensitive, which is suitable for the detection of chlorate and perchlorate in rice.
